Montmartre
Iconic district in the north of Paris, Montmartre is nicknamed the “Village”. Famous for the great number of artists mainly painters who lived in its steep cobble-stone streets, Montmartre is currently one of the most visited areas in the City of Lights. Moulin Rouge
Our tour begins opposite a quintessential Parisian landmark: the Moulin Rouge windmill. We’ll start the climb up the hill, spotting the café where the film Amélie was shot and Van Gogh’s home as we go. Our first stop will be at one of Paris’ best bakers, winner of many prestigious prizes for its bread and pastries. Here we will taste one of France’s most famous patisserie: a deliciously buttery croissant. Is there any better way to start your morning in Paris?
